Safe, Sane, Consensual (ssc) Principle

The safe, sane, consensual (SSC) principle is a foundational concept in the BDSM community that emphasizes the importance of safety, sanity, and mutual consent in all activities.

Key Features

  • Safety: prioritizing physical and emotional safety for all parties involved
  • Sanity: ensuring activities are mentally and emotionally healthy for participants
  • Consensual: requiring informed and voluntary consent from all individuals
  • Respect: promoting respect for boundaries, limits, and communication

Pros

  • Promotes a culture of safety and consent within BDSM practices
  • Encourages open communication and negotiation between partners
  • Helps prevent harm or abuse in kink and fetish communities

Cons

  • May be difficult to enforce in practice, leading to potential violations of SSC principles
  • Some individuals may misuse the concept to justify harmful behavior
